How Enamel Pin Filling Machines Streamline the Badge Manufacturing Process
The production of hardware badges requires several precise steps to ensure that each piece meets industry standards. One of the most important machines used in this process is the Enamel pin filling machine. This advanced equipment helps manufacturers achieve accurate, consistent results when filling enamel into badges. Below, we discuss six essential processes involved in hardware badge manufacturing:
1. Design and Planning
Every hardware badge begins with a thoughtful design. The design is created using digital tools that allow for detailed planning and adjustments, ensuring that the finished product meets the desired specifications.
2. Mold Creation
The next step involves creating a mold based on the design. The mold is essential for mass-producing badges with consistent quality and design accuracy.
3. Material Selection
Materials such as brass, copper, and zinc are commonly used for their durability and ability to hold intricate details during the manufacturing process.
4. Enamel Filling
The Enamel pin filling machine is used to apply enamel accurately and efficiently to each badge. The Enamel emoji lapel pin filling machine further enhances this process by enabling even more precise application for smaller, more complex designs.
5. Curing and Hardening
Once the enamel is applied, the badges are heated in an oven to cure the enamel. This process ensures the enamel stays vibrant and durable over time, making the badge resistant to wear and fading.
6. Quality Control
The final step involves rigorous quality control checks to ensure each badge meets the required standards before it is shipped to customers.
